Buffers, Drivers, Receivers, Transceivers Texas Instruments SN7407NSR Overview

The SN7407NSR from Texas Instruments stands out in the market of Buffers, Drivers, Receivers, Transceivers as a robust non-inverting buffer. This integrated circuit ensures high-voltage outputs from a standard TTL logic family, operating up to 5.25V, making it highly adaptable for interfacing with higher voltage levels while maintaining signal integrity. Its design in a 14SOP package ensures ease of integration into various circuit layouts, optimizing footprint and enhancing system reliability. The SN7407NSR is particularly tailored for applications that require robust driving capability and reliable performance under varying electrical conditions, thus ensuring efficient operations across a broad range of industrial applications.

SN7407NSR Features

The SN7407NSR is designed with multiple key features that make it ideal for a wide range of applications. It includes six independent buffer drivers for driving high voltages. It is capable of handling up to 30V at the output, with continuous output current up to 40mA per channel. Its input compatible with TTL levels adds to its versatility, and the device ensures a low power consumption which is crucial for energy-efficient operations. Additionally, the SN7407NSR's design in a small-outline package allows for compact and efficient PCB layout.
